Causes of School Jitters

One primary cause of school jitters is the fear of the unknown. New surroundings, unfamiliar faces, and the apprehension of meeting academic expectations can all contribute to students’ sense of unease. Transitioning to a new school, grade, or classroom often amplifies this fear, making it vital for educators and parents to understand the challenges faced by students during such transitions.

Additionally, peer pressure and social anxiety can significantly contribute to school jitters. Students may worry about fitting in, making friends, or being accepted by their peers. The fear of judgment and rejection can create a stressful environment, affecting the mental and emotional well-being of students.

Effects of School Jitters

The effects of school jitters on students can be profound and far-reaching. These feelings of anxiety can hinder students’ ability to concentrate, leading to decreased academic performance. Persistent school jitters can also impact students’ confidence, self-esteem, and overall motivation. This, in turn, may result in a reluctance to participate in class activities, affecting their social and emotional development.

Furthermore, the emotional toll of school jitters can lead to physical symptoms such as headaches, stomachaches, and sleep disturbances. These physical manifestations not only interfere with students’ daily routines but can also contribute to a cycle of increased anxiety and stress.

1. Establish a Supportive Routine

Experts suggest that establishing a structured daily routine can greatly contribute to reducing school jitters. Create a schedule that includes time for studying, breaks, extracurricular activities, and adequate sleep. Following a consistent routine helps in developing a sense of stability and control, thus minimizing stress levels.

2. Build Positive Relationships

Nurturing positive relationships with teachers, classmates, and other supportive individuals can significantly alleviate school jitters. Engage in open and friendly communication, participate in group activities, and seek advice from mentors and peers. Connecting with others promotes a sense of belonging, fosters collaboration, and provides emotional support, which can be immensely helpful in navigating the challenges of school.

  • Regularly attend school events and extracurricular activities to meet new people and expand your social circle.
  • Consider joining clubs or organizations that align with your interests and passions.
  • Practice active listening and empathy when interacting with others, fostering a positive and supportive environment.

3. Utilize Relaxation Techniques

The utilization of relaxation techniques has been proven to be an effective approach in reducing school-related jitters. Engage in activities such as deep breathing exercises, mindfulness meditation, or practicing yoga to promote a state of calmness and alleviate anxiety. Taking regular breaks throughout the school day to engage in these techniques can help reset your mind and regain focus.

  1. Find a quiet and comfortable space to practice deep breathing exercises.
  2. Explore guided meditation apps or videos that cater specifically to reducing anxiety and improving concentration.
  3. Consider incorporating physical activities into your routine to alleviate stress and promote overall well-being.

Understanding Resilience: A Key to Overcoming School Jitters

Understanding Resilience: A Key to Overcoming School Jitters

Resilience is the capacity to adapt and thrive in the face of adversity or stress. It involves the ability to maintain a positive outlook, persevere through challenges, and bounce back after setbacks. Building resilience in students is crucial in helping them navigate the ups and downs of school life and overcome their jitters.

Empowering Students: Strategies for Building Resilience

Empowering students to overcome school jitters involves equipping them with a range of strategies and techniques to build resilience. These strategies include:

  • Developing a Growth Mindset: Encouraging students to view challenges as opportunities for growth and development rather than as barriers to success.
  • Cultivating Self-Confidence: Helping students recognize their strengths and capabilities, and providing opportunities for them to experience success.
  • Fostering Emotional Intelligence: Teaching students how to identify and manage their emotions effectively, and encouraging empathy and understanding towards others.
  • Encouraging Positive Self-Talk: Guiding students to replace negative self-talk with positive and affirming statements, helping them develop a more optimistic outlook.
  • Building Supportive Relationships: Creating a supportive and inclusive school environment, where students feel connected to their peers and educators.

By implementing these strategies, educators can play a vital role in building resilience in students and empowering them to overcome their school jitters.
